872 Commits

Author SHA1 Message Date
Jinhao
443b3dcd87 update experimental::filesystem 2015-12-29 01:11:03 +08:00
Jinhao
7cc173022a use UTF-8 for string representation 2015-12-28 01:30:26 +08:00
Jinhao
fec3aa3c8e Merge branch 'qPCR4vir-workarounds_MinWG481' into develop 2015-12-27 13:15:14 +08:00
Jinhao
3856543daf fix wrong position of sub menu 2015-12-22 23:47:56 +08:00
Jinhao
9bb0e8eb34 fix an issue of child root window(nested_form) 2015-12-22 00:41:58 +08:00
Jinhao
75800b2e78 fix a crash when setting focus if prev is null 2015-12-20 03:00:33 +08:00
Jinhao
1446849454 fix non-popup root window(nested_form) issues 2015-12-18 01:00:33 +08:00
Jinhao
25743b14a9 add native_interface::set_parent 2015-12-18 00:57:46 +08:00
Jinhao
54ca38d575 improve support of MinGW-w64 2015-12-17 00:07:44 +08:00
Jinhao
2ca11d4e25 fix compile errors under Linux 2015-12-16 01:21:44 +08:00
Jinhao
c260eebbc3 use UTF-8 for string representation 2015-12-15 21:46:24 +08:00
Jinhao
1d9b75b1c2 fix std numeric conversions errors for GCC 5.1 2015-12-15 15:51:29 +08:00
qPCR4vir
0bd5483cdd reorganize 2015-12-14 12:44:37 +01:00
qPCR4vir
986f5ea9ad Reorganize options in CMakeList.txt at the beginning with right defaults. Add condition in endif() 2015-12-14 02:33:11 +01:00
qPCR4vir
cfc73be627 VERBOSE_PREPROCESSOR "Show annoying debug messages during compilation." 2015-12-14 02:32:56 +01:00
qPCR4vir
0c59065d9e Document config.hpp 2015-12-14 01:55:46 +01:00
qPCR4vir
f59afb9aa4 Build demos 2015-12-14 01:49:47 +01:00
qPCR4vir
d5721fbe30 STD_make_unique_NOT_SUPPORTED "Add support for make_unique<>()." 2015-12-14 01:44:22 +01:00
Jinhao
8fc84938bf use UTF-8 for string representation 2015-12-14 00:30:03 +08:00
Jinhao
009e7e7647 change to_native_string into to_nstring 2015-12-10 00:36:58 +08:00
Jinhao
112deadd16 elimiate nana::string for listbox 2015-12-10 00:24:31 +08:00
Jinhao
049a36e1f7 Merge branch 'develop' into prepare-utf8 2015-12-09 00:32:23 +08:00
Jinhao
22ddc02184 Merge branch 'develop' 2015-12-09 00:31:32 +08:00
Jinhao
2ac3b8128d fix a listbox issue occurs when resizing without adjusting item offset 2015-12-09 00:19:28 +08:00
Jinhao
9ca02afe61 fix a issue that listbox draws string outside a column 2015-12-08 23:53:56 +08:00
Jinhao
ed58fcf85a fix a issue that children does not show when showing lite-widget 2015-12-08 23:05:02 +08:00
Jinhao
871ddd25af fix issues of tabbar::relate and tabbar::append 2015-12-08 22:54:27 +08:00
Jinhao
689738acb1 Merge branch 'hotfix-1.2' into prepare-utf8 2015-12-08 01:57:44 +08:00
Jinhao
42a861b902 Merge branch 'develop' 2015-12-08 01:54:13 +08:00
Jinhao
3d1c18cc50 Merge branch 'hotfix-1.2' into develop 2015-12-08 01:52:51 +08:00
Jinhao
e189d6559e remove warning for preprocessor 2015-12-08 00:42:07 +08:00
Jinhao
8a243ad0d7 add detection of clang 2015-12-07 02:52:30 +08:00
Jinhao
dce320d544 remove platform_spec_selector.cpp and bedrock_selector.cpp 2015-12-05 15:52:31 +08:00
Jinhao
3863a0dc60 improve the detection for GCC 2015-12-05 14:03:46 +08:00
Jinhao
babcacd63d Merge branch 'hotfix-1.2' into prepare-utf8 2015-12-04 23:44:11 +08:00
Jinhao
21a5e2fc2e fix i18n escape char '\\' issue 2015-12-04 23:21:33 +08:00
Jinhao
a5df90f8a9 remove platform preprocess check in platform_spec.cpp 2015-12-04 23:13:22 +08:00
Jinhao
0d0e58172d Merge branch 'qPCR4vir-cmake_mingw' into hotfix-1.2 2015-12-04 22:29:55 +08:00
qPCR4vir
b8b174b1f2 FIX: un-comment Linux 2015-12-04 10:03:52 +01:00
qPCR4vir
48b622acc7 why some variables are not set by CLion / CMake ? __GNUC__ etc.
I got libnana.a, but not the test.exe, why?
2015-12-03 20:24:32 +01:00
qPCR4vir
3ad8f5a641 Simplify CMake file and config.h 2015-12-03 20:24:20 +01:00
qPCR4vir
f9f70cf08b Simplify CMake file 2015-12-03 20:24:07 +01:00
qPCR4vir
f7f8db5337 FIX: MinGW no expose functions in std:: 2015-12-03 20:23:56 +01:00
qPCR4vir
221e9f6624 FIX MinGW workaround bring some macro small ? 2015-12-03 20:23:44 +01:00
qPCR4vir
74be76e49a MinGW workaround with USE_github_com_meganz_mingw_std_threads 2015-12-03 20:22:31 +01:00
qPCR4vir
003b0b4041 simplify automatic project generation - return config + USE_github_com_meganz_mingw_std_threads 2015-12-03 20:22:18 +01:00
qPCR4vir
4b57b76ffb simplify automatic project generation 2015-12-03 20:14:32 +01:00
qPCR4vir
3a04e10d69 ignore .ideas 2015-12-03 20:14:15 +01:00
Jinhao
faa33817e2 add insert/append/erase methods to template class tabbar 2015-12-04 00:20:29 +08:00
Jinhao
e8266b5ae8 add native_string_type for internal use 2015-12-03 01:49:44 +08:00